|Summary|ofthe main||This year Matthew<br>and Michelle Barrow spent time with|
|achievements<br>ofthe charity<br>during the year|||each ofthe visionaries,<br>and visited each ofthe projects.<br>They were challenged<br>by the vast need<br>in each place.|
||||None ofthe projects had as yet recovered<br>from the covid|
||||time.<br>It is estimated<br>that at least five years will be|
||||needed to recover financially<br>and practically<br>from covid.|
||||In Uganda,<br>Edward<br>Nsimbi<br>had started<br>his income|
||||generation<br>project and<br>it was adding about f200-8300|
||||per month.<br>Sebastian<br>has still to buy the cameras that|
||||will start the project off in Naluwerere.|
||||In Kenya, one ofthe Child2Child<br>young<br>men went to Itigo|
||||to help with the block making<br>plant there. Unfortunately,|
||||he had been drinking<br>over the covid period and so has|
||||had to undergo<br>rehabilitation<br>himself.<br>It is hoped that|
||||when he has finished the rehabilitation<br>he will be able to|
||||get back to training<br>others.|
||||In Nakuru,<br>Patrick has had to make some hard decisions|
||||as to the size ofthe school due to financial constraints.|
||||In Malawi, Damson<br>had yet to finish the posho<br>mill as his|
||||builder had let him down, as had the electricity supplier.|
||||In the UK, two churches were visited:|
||||Saltisford<br>Church<br>in Warwick|
||||St Matthew's<br>Church<br>in Worthing|
||||One school was visited where we talked with year 2|
||||about Kenya.|
||||We have produced<br>a monthly<br>news update<br>keeping<br>our|
||||supporters<br>up to date with news from Africa, and a|
||||monthly<br>prayer meeting was held to seek God for the|
||||works and people we are involved<br>with.|
